Cranberry Syrup Sauce

Give this sweet berry sauce a try — it's so good! Cranberry syrup sauce is a tangy little treat, perfect spread on bread or served alongside tea. Adjust the sweetness to taste, and if you'd like it thinner, just stir in a splash of cooled boiled water.

    1. Wash the cranberries, put them in a saucepan with a little water (100 ml), and bring to a boil. 2. Add the applesauce and orange zest, cover, and cook until the cranberries are soft and have burst apart. 3. Stir often as it cooks to keep it from scorching, since the sauce gets fairly thick. At the end, add vanilla to taste, and thin the sauce with cooled boiled water to the consistency you like, if you wish. Serve it chilled. Enjoy!
